Which three plate touch the South American plate ?

Social Studies
2 answers:
Marizza181 [45]3 years ago
7 0
South American plate is a relatively large sized plate located below the continent, South America. South American plate is bounded by African plate in the east, Nazca plate in the west, Antarctic plate and Scotia plate in the south, and Caribbean plate and North American plate in the north.
